Phone screen says:
SW REV CHECK FAIL : [aboot]Fused 4 > Binary 1

It looks like you're trying to flash a firmware which is older than the one installed. Try to find latest firmware.

I had the same problem, kies didn't work, neither did odin. I used every fix suggestion I could find.
It finally dawned on me that the battery was holding everything in place. I took off the back of my Tab 2 and removed
the battery. I re-installed the battery after 10 minutes and was able to re install a stock rom. I hope thishelps.
